The Marygold Companies Inc is an international holding company focused on acquiring and growing profitable businesses. Its main segments include U.S. Fund Management through USCF Investments, Food Products via Gourmet Foods and Printstock Products in New Zealand, Beauty Products under the Original Sprout brand, and formerly Security Systems through Brigadier, sold in 2025. The majority of revenue comes from fund management. The company operates in the USA, New Zealand, the United Kingdom, and Canada, with the majority of revenue generated from the USA. Its business approach focuses on strengthening financial services, expanding fintech, and managing a diverse portfolio for growth.
Culp Inc manufactures, markets mattress fabrics for bedding and upholstery fabrics for residential, commercial, and hospitality furnishings. The company has two operating segments: Mattress fabrics, which generate maximum revenue, and Upholstery fabrics. The mattress fabrics segment manufactures, sources, and sells fabrics and mattress covers to bedding manufacturers. The upholstery fabrics segment develops, sources, manufactures, and sells fabrics to residential, commercial, and hospitality furniture manufacturers. Geographically, it derives key revenue from the United States of America.
